Detectives from the Cyber Unit at Lahav 433 have arrested a resident of Ashkelon on suspicion of introducing malware to dozens of companies in Israel. The Cyber Unit is conducting an investigation into a suspect, a resident of Ashkelon.

Ashkelon man arrested by Israel Police Cyber Unit for allegedly introducing malware to dozens of Israeli companies.

During the covert investigation, the unit’s investigators tracked the suspect’s identity, and after complex analytical activity, they managed to discover his identity. Today, in the morning hours, the unit moved to the overt phase of the investigation, arrested the suspect, and conducted a search of his home and several other companies. The suspect was questioned under caution for offenses under the Computer Law, wiretapping, invasion of privacy, and additional offenses. At the end of his interrogation, the suspect was brought to the Rishon LeZion Magistrate’s Court for an arrest extension. The case is being accompanied by the Cyber Department of the State Attorney’s Office.
